The patch
around which the neighbors are identified, or the patch
where
the turtle
is located on around which the neighbors are identified, is not
returned.
If `torus = FALSE`, `agents` located on the edges of the `world` have less than `nNeighbors` patches around them. If `torus = TRUE`, all `agents` located on the edges of the `world` have `nNeighbors` patches around them, which some may be on the other sides of the `world`.
Matrix (ncol
= 3) with the first column pxcor
and the second column pycor
representing the coordinates of the neighbors
patches
around the agents
and the third column id
representing
the id
of the agents
in the order provided.
